Avantis U.S. Small Cap Value ETF (AVUV) Research
This ETF allocates capital across a broad spectrum of small-capitalization companies within the U.S. market. Its core strategy seeks to enhance expected returns by identifying firms with robust profitability that are trading at what Avantis considers attractive, low valuations. While incorporating the hallmarks of passive indexing – such as broad diversification, low portfolio turnover, and transparent exposures – the fund also aims to add value through active investment decisions informed by real-time market pricing. It benefits from an efficient portfolio management and trading approach, meticulously designed to boost returns while simultaneously reducing unnecessary costs and potential risks for investors. Ultimately, this ETF is built to seamlessly complement an investor's overall asset allocation.
